Title:
OVERCURRENT PROTECTION CIRCUIT
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JPH03277122
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

PURPOSE: To prevent the destruction of a switching element caused by a response delay of an insulating amplifier and a malfunction of an over-current detection circuit caused by noise by taking an over-current detection signal into a driving signal cutoff circuit after insulating by a photo coupler.

CONSTITUTION: Terminal voltage of each of shunt resistances SH1-SH3 is input into an insulating amplifier 1 installed for each phase at the same time with being input into an over-current detection circuit 2. A current of each phase is compared with a preliminarily set overcurrent level. When the current of each phase is at the set overcurrent level or above, it is put into an OR circuit 10 through photo couplers PC3 and PC4. Then the output from the OR circuit is input into a base cutoff circuit 8 as a base cutoff signal S1. A base signal of a power transistor is cut off through a base driver BD1 and photo couplers PC2 and BD2.
